OverviewDo not exceed maximum cable lengthsDo not exceed minimum bend radius for a given cable typeAvoid twisting cableSuggested Pull GripsRouting Fiber Optic CablesInstallation ChecklistCleaning Techniques for Fiber Optic CablesCleaning Fiber Optic Cable EndsSERCOS Attenuation LimitsSystem Field Testing Verify Transmitter Output PowerSystem Field Testing Verify Receiver PowerConfigure test module as test light sourcePurposeHard Clad Silica Glass Fiber Optic Cable Mechanical LimitsRockwell Automation SupportOptical fibers require special care during installation to ensure reliable operation. Installation guidelines regarding minimum bend radius, tensile loads, twisting, squeezing, or pinching of cable must be followed.
